We are currently seeking a Manager of A&R Administration to be part of a very busy department and work closely with A&R, Business & Legal Affairs, and the Production department that serves 6 major record labels.
How You'll LEAD:
If you enjoy spreadsheets, numbers, showing off your organizational skills, and assisting the creative A&R process from behind the scenes, this is the perfect job for you. Your days will include tracking important delivery paperwork, collecting and distributing audio, accounts payable activity, collaborating with artist/producer management, troubleshooting budget concerns with A&R, providing accurate and timely information to Senior Management and so much more.
How You'll CREATE:
Work closely with A&R department during the recording process to ensure projects are turned in within delivery deadlines,
Analyzing and administering the recording budgets for an entire roster of recording projects in a variety of music genres.
Managing all aspects of the Accounts Payable process in relation to recording budgets.
Providing excellent customer service both internally and externally to all stakeholders throughout the recording process; ensuring timely payment, accuracy, and guidance throughout.
Filing and processing of all union-related (SAG-AFTRA & AFM) contracts as applicable.
Budget analysis, creation, and reforecasting.
Manage Accounts Payable activity along with the corporate finance teams.
Gathering sample and side artist required paperwork to ensure music is cleared for release into the marketplace.
Liaise with senior management and A&R regarding the recording process and creative plan.
Collaborate with A&R to issue Purchase Orders, authorize expenditures and travel.
Collaborate with A&R to setup recording & mastering sessions, coordinating studio, engineers, and talent.
Draft remixer agreements
Gather tax forms and union paperwork to ensure compliance with the Collective Bargaining Agreement.
Prepare reports and project summaries as requested by various departments.
Provide information as requested by the Royalties team.
Assist the VP with monthly financial forecasting of project spend.
Ensure accurate record keeping for the purposes of proper documentation to indemnify the corporation.
Collect, deliver, and vault audio masters for each project.
Work with the production department in the preparation and editing of label copy and approving packaging
Deliver final audio and meta data to Production Department to meet deadlines
